END GOVT. SHUTDOWN
Summary
Affirms that no one wins when the federal government shuts down. Urges Congress to maintain continuous federal operations through timely appropriations or continuing resolutions, to reject shutdowns as a negotiating tactic, and to provide predictable funding that protects families, workers, and the broader economy. Reaffirms a bipartisan commitment to stability and problem-solving and to stand ready to work with Illinois's Congressional Delegation, Democrats and Republicans alike, to keep government functioning and focused on the people we serve.
